Understanding Montana Net Metering Laws

Net metering is a billing mechanism that credits solar energy system owners for the electricity they add to the grid. When your solar panels generate more electricity than your home consumes, that excess power is sent back to the utility grid. Under Montana net metering laws, your utility provider credits your account for this surplus electricity, typically at the full retail rate. This effectively allows you to use the grid as a kind of battery, storing your excess production for when your panels aren’t generating as much, like at night or on cloudy days, by reducing your overall electricity bill.

Maximizing Your Solar Investment with Solar Utility Credits

One of the primary benefits of net metering for homeowners is the financial advantage. By receiving solar utility credits for the energy you send back to the grid, you can significantly reduce or even eliminate your monthly electricity bills. These credits represent a tangible return on your solar investment, accelerating the payback period and increasing your overall savings. It transforms your rooftop into an income-generating asset, contributing to both your personal finances and the stability of the local energy supply.

Enhancing Energy Independence with Solar Backup Battery Montana

While net metering is fantastic for balancing your daily energy use, what happens when the grid goes down? This is where a robust solar backup battery Montana becomes invaluable. Integrating a battery storage system with your solar setup provides true power outage protection. During a grid outage, your battery can kick in automatically, keeping essential appliances running and ensuring your home remains powered independently. This combination of solar, net metering, and battery storage offers unparalleled energy security and peace of mind.
